Reminding ourselves of the current contextWhy might HE / higher-level skills matter?

2008 recession, 2013 0.6% UK growth, maybe even triple dip? Still c. 1m young people unemployed Plan A austerity, £11.5bn savings this Spending Round UK Plc, a globally competitive knowledge economy? Radical changes to make UK HE / skills systems more ‘responsive’…

2030 global labour force to grow from 2.9bn today to 3.5 billion Projected shortfall of 13% (40m) HE-level workers by 2020 60% of global labour force growth from India, South Asia and Africa Changing nature of both the workplace and the workers

McKinsey http://goo.gl/svjKK

Trends in UK HE / higher skills provisionWhat is currently happening on the ground?

Funding increasingly follows learners in England, 4 nations diverging

Increasingly competitive and marketised system, student ‘choice’e.g. competing for 115k ABB students, Key Information Set (KIS)

Total HE sector income up 2.8% and ‘efficiencies’ made... but wide variation, low surpluses, 3.5% fall in 2012/13 learners

Growing (narrow?) focus on outcomes by all stakeholderseducation = employment = £ / growth ?

Institutions seeking to be distinctive and attractivee.g. How many are ‘The employability university’

Changing UK HE / higher skillsWhat alternatives are emerging?

Ongoing debate about alternative (to) HE

(Higher) apprenticeships, with strong government backing…but ongoing challenges to delivering them well at scale

Large employers increasingly targeting school leavers sometimes incorporating HE… the Morrisons Academy at Hull

Unisometimes not… Deloitte BrightStart

Cost of HE; recent UK rises, USA already highe.g. $100k Thiel fellowships (not to go to uni)

Corrosive narrative of ‘too many thick kids on Mickey-mouse courses’
